Keaton
As we do our feeding route one morning, with temperatures in the teens, I spotted something on the side of the road. It finally registered that this was actually a dog but a dog so close to death, it was urgent that we rescue him no matter what the cost or how hard it might be. The poor thing ran from us with his hunched bony body and with every step he took, you could tell he was hurting. None of us wanted to see him run, we knew he might not survive an all out chase. He would collapse in certain areas when he thought he lost us, but when he saw us again he would take off. On a vibe, we thought he might have gone in to this burnt out house to hide. He did. But when he reappeared he couldn't run anymore. His sick body was giving out. All he could do to protect himself from us was growl and snap but his broken down frame could run no more. I thought if I could throw my coat over him, I could just grab him and let him bite. I would get him to my car at any cost. It worked! Safe now at Chippewa Animal Hospital, the staff will heal his many, many wounds. Stray Rescue will heal his soul. He would never have survived one more night (the coldest night of the year). This is a special dog. One day we all can't wait to see him go to his special loving forever home where suffering is not in the vocabulary.
